Seager went 2-for-5 with four RBI from a run-scoring double and three-run home run in Tuesday's 12-3 win over the Twins.

Seager's 349-foot shot to right in the fourth put an early cap on what was a spectacular scoring barrage by the Mariners and served as his first RBI since he also compiled four versus the Rockies on May 30. The veteran third baseman has hit safely in 13 of his last 16 games, posting six doubles, a pair of round trippers, 10 RBI, .356 wOBA and 44.2 percent hard contact rate over that stretch.
